Monmouth Police Officers Complete Mandatory Training

Share

The Monmouth police officers have completed 150 hours of training mandated by the Training and Standards Board. Communications Director Ken Helms says the training is part of the new Police Reform Act:

“The training included Civil Rights, Use of Force, Cultural Competency, Procedural Justice, some law updates, and Constitutional law enforcement activity. That is all a part of the Police Reform Act that the state passed through a couple months ago.”
